I have a system that consists of two components, a client and a server. The client will always get installed and the server is optional. If the server is selected to be installed SQL Server also needs to be installed as a prereq.
I have created a separate msi for both the client and the server. I have created a bundle that includes both the SQL Server install along with the server msi. How can I take the three components and create a feature tree so that the client is always installed and the server is optional?
